Changeset 7397

Show
Ignore:
Timestamp:
09/11/07 22:54:39
Author:
robert
Message:

Added log2(int) and log2(uint) methods

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• OpenSceneGraph/trunk/include/osg/Math

    r7396 r7397  
    197197inline float log2(float v) { return static_cast<float>(log(v)) * INVLN_2; } 
    198198inline double log2(double v) { return static_cast<double>(log(v)) * INVLN_2; } 
     199inline float log2(int v) { return log2(static_cast<float>(v)); } 
     200inline float log2(unsigned int v) { return log2(static_cast<float>(v)); } 
    199201 
    200202#if defined(WIN32) && !defined(__CYGWIN__) && !defined(__MWERKS__)